I believe the ones you are referring to are the eight sided, either  
black or white, phenolic knobs. They push in to latch and turn a  
quarter turn clockwise to unlatch. The colored part resembles an  
older plastic similar to Bakelite. I have three white ones in my  
trailer that I switched out from black ones. I traded two straight  
out and swapped out for another with some other vintage pieces. The  
last remaining black one is worn out. These are really getting hard  
to find so keep your eyes and ears open for someone who is completely  
redoing their interior.
